What Does Error E21 Mean?
The Candy washing machine E21 error indicates a drainage issue, where the washer fails to remove water efficiently during the cycle. This may result in a full drum display or unusual sounds during the spin cycle. The most common causes include a clogged drain system or a malfunctioning drain pump. It’s essential to address this error promptly to avoid further complications.
Common Symptoms:
- Water not draining at end of cycle
- Cycle stops or pauses with error displayed
- Machine may display E21 repeatedly until addressed
Possible Causes
- Clogged drain system (filter or hose) (high)
- Faulty or obstructed drain pump (medium)
- Pressure/water level sensor fault or incorrect water level detection (low)
How to Fix Error E21
DIY Fix Check and Clean Drain Filter and Hose
- Unplug the washing machine from power.
- Locate and open the drain pump filter access panel (often at the bottom front).
- Place a shallow tray to catch residual water.
- Unscrew and remove the filter, then clean out lint, debris, or foreign objects.
- Inspect the drain hose behind the machine for kinks and remove any blockages.
DIY Fix Reset the Machine
- After cleaning, plug the washer back in.
- Turn it off and wait a few minutes to allow the control system to reset.
- Restart a short or drain/spin cycle to check if the error persists.
Technician Only Inspect and Service Drain Pump and Internal Components
- Remove the back or bottom panel to access the drain pump.
- Check the pump impeller for obstructions or damage.
- Test the pump motor and electrical connections.
- If the pump is faulty, replace with OEM‑specified part.
Parts needed: drain pump assembly, hose clamps, possibly new drain hose
Technician Only Check Pressure/Water Level Sensor and Control Connections
- Access the suspension and pressure switch assembly.
- Inspect the pressure tube and switch for blockage or defects.
- Test sensor functionality with appropriate tools.
- Replace sensor if defective and verify wiring integrity.
Parts needed: pressure switch/level sensor, tubing
